Head Trauma Decision Rules for Children < 2 Years Old

Very Low Risk of Intracranial Injury if All of the Following Are Present

  • Normal Mental Status
    • Altered mental status is defined as:
      • GCS < 15
      • Agitation
      • Somnolence
      • Slow responses when developmentally appropriate
      • Repetitive questioning
  • No Hematoma or Isolated Frontal Hematoma
  • No LOC or LOC < 5 Seconds
  • Non-severe Injury Mechanism
    • Severe defined as any of the following:
      • Motor vehicle crash with:
        • Patient ejection
        • Death of another passenger
        • Rollover
      • Pedestrian or bicyclist without helmet struck by a motorized vehicle
      • Falls of > 3 feet
      • Head struck by a high-impact object
  • No Palpable Skull Fracture
  • Acting Normally According to the Parents
